Our contingent of former winners in the latest FFS Cup has already been more than halved by the first round results.

Joe, MCH, Gribude and A Manager Has No Name were all elminated at the first stage following Gameweek 28’s qualifiers.

In what proved a nightmare Gameweek 29 for most, only three of the ex-champions progressed to round three.

Joe was knocked out by Force Majeure by a 40-34 scoreline and MCH fell to True Deadzoner 41-33.

Gribude’s score of 44 was not enough to get past Mas7our‘s 56 while A Manager Has No Name was unfortunate to fall foul of one Gameweek 29’s 60+ scores.

He was taken out by Dodgy Keeper whose captaining of Gonzalo Higuain (£9.6m) earned him a score of 60 points.

Things went a little better for 2EyedTurk, who edged past Hasselbaink Forever by a score of 48-44.

Wild Rover‘s 50 points saw him eliminate Boris Bodega, who managed just 40.

donnellyc was fortunate enough to catch an opponent with one of the worst Gameweek scores in the first round. Bragazeti‘s 26 points ensured 31 was sufficient for the victory.

Fantasy Football Scout Cup Round Dates
Qualifying – Gameweek 28

Round 1 – Gameweek 29
Round 2 – Gameweek 30
Round 3 – Gameweek 31
Round 4 – Gameweek 32
Round 5 – Gameweek 33
Round 6 – Gameweek 34
Quarter-Final – Gameweek 35
Semi-Finals – Gameweek 36
Final and third place play-off – Gameweek 37
